1989-2019: EVERLAM plant celebrates 30 years

EVERLAM’s PVB sheet extrusion plant in Hamm Uentrop (Germany) celebrates its 30th anniversary of production of PVB film this year.

Manufacturing a PVB interlayer to the highest industry standards is a specialist’s business that requires real know-how as many different factors can impact the quality of the end product. The success of the manufacturing operations comes from EVERLAM’s high standards and ability to consistently produce PVB film of the highest quality.

ISO 9001 certified, the plant and the team who runs it are reputed throughout the glass laminating industry.

Over the past 3 decades the plant has undergone changes, extensions and upgrades to keep up to the standards:

  • 1989: start up of the extrusion line by DuPont for the production of Butacite®
  • 2001: line extension + jumbo width for architectural products (3,21 m wide capability.)
  • 2012: lean packaging hall
  • 2015: the plant is taken over by EVERLAM and Butacite® becomes EVERLAM™ PVB interlayer
  • 2016: pilot line installed to provide extra capability to develop new products
  • 2019: enhanced extrusion capability

Germany is considered the center of chemical process expertise. Located in the Ruhr valley, the plant benefits from excellent connections to major roads and railways networks and is at the door step of international ports such as Hamburg, Rotterdam and Antwerp.
